资源简介:
A metalloligand
type of synthetic route has been followed to generate
a novel heterometallic three-dimensional (3D)-coordination polymer
containing Cu(II) and trimethyltin as nodes. The first step of this
synthetic path consisted of the preparation of a two-dimensional-coordination
polymer of Cu(II), [Cu(μ-LH)2]n (1) (LH2 = pyridine-2,5-dicarboxylic
acid). The reaction of in situ generated 1 with Me3SnCl afforded the heterometallic 3D-coordination polymer,
[Cu(Me3Sn)2(μ-L)2]n (2). The latter is a 4,4-connected
polymer with a sqc topology. This 3D-framework contains a paddle-wheel-shaped
core comprised of two heterometallic (CuII/SnIV) macrocycles.
